WAY-181187 is an agonist of the serotonin (5-HT) receptor subtype 5-HT6.1,2 It increases intracellular cAMP levels in HeLa cells expressing 5-HT6 (EC50 = 6.5 nM).2 WAY-181187 selectively binds to 5-HT6 over 5-HT2B, 5-HT2C, and 5-HT7 (Kis = 2,458, 124, and 679 nM, respectively). It is also selective for 5-HT6 over a panel of 31 receptors and ion channels at 100 nM. It increases extracellular GABA levels in the rat frontal cortex when administered at a dose of 10 mg/kg. WAY-181187 (178 mg/kg) reduces schedule-induced polydipsia, an adjunctive model of compulsive disorder, in rats. It also reduces immobility in a modified forced swim test in rats when administered at a dose of 17 mg/kg, indicating antidepressant-like activity, and reduces the duration of defensive burying in rats at 10 and 17 mg/kg, indicating anxiolytic-like activity.3
